The Seventh International Symposium on the History of Arabic .. .... Sciences
November, 2000

Subjects of the Symposium:

  1. History of Basic Sciences
....Mathematics, Chemistry, Physics, Astronomy, Geology, Botany and Zoology.
2. History of Medicine
....Medicine, Pharmacology and Veterinary Medicine.
3. History of Technology
....Mechanic, Hydraulic, Architecture, Military and Industrial Engineering.
Language:
Research papers should be submitted in one the following languages:



 

> Arabic
> English
> French
> German

Papers written in other languages are accepted if they are abstracted in English.

Location:
The symposium will be held in Al Ain, United Arab Emirates
Participation Requirements:
  1- Participants are supposed to be faculty members at Universities, Institutions or.. .... Centers of Studies interested in subjects of the symposium, or researchers...... .... who have published important papers on the history of Arabic Sciences.
2- Papers should be delivered in one of the languages of the symposium, and in. .... all cases an English abstract is required.
3- Papers should be original, and have not been published or delivered at any . .... ... other conference on symposia.
4- Papers should be submitted typewritten to the committee of the symposium by. .... the end of April 2000. 5- Participants will be informed of the acceptance of ..... .... their papers a month from the date of receiving them.

* On Sunday,19th September 1999,Zayed Center for Heritage and History organised a lecture entitled: " The lslamic and Arabic Reaction towards Globalisatoin", by Dr. Ahmad Al-Kubaisi.
* On 17th October 1999,the Center organised a lecture for Dr. Ahmad Saad Al-Din Tarabin, professor of History atDamascus University. The lecture was on " Jerusalem and the Jewish Settlement".
* On 15th November 1999, Dr. Abdul-Aziz Al-Douri, The renowned Arab Historian gave a lecture on "The Historical Strucure of the Arabs".
* The Centre, in cooperation with the UAE University, supported a conference, held in Al-Ain on 22-23th November 1999.
* The Centre organised a training course on Heritage from 19th June 1999 until 16th July 1999. Thirty female graduates and students participated in the course.
* Mr Abdul-Bari Atwan, Editor-in-Chief of the daily Al-Qudis gave a lecture on 31st January 2000.
